Emergency crews responded to a vehicle slide-off into the Coeur d’Alene River Monday night on Silver Valley Road between Osburn and Silverton. Although the one occupant walked away with only minor injuries, officials stress that motorists need to remain cautious through the winter season. Even with warm weather during the day, night temperatures can dip below freezing and make previously safe roads hazardous.
